Overall Meaning

The lyrics of Meghan Trainor's song "Superwoman" convey a powerful message of the struggles that comes with the pressure of being a superwoman. The song talks about the various expectations she has for her life like wanting to sing for her fans, starting a family, and buying a house in Malibu. However, she goes on to admit that she's only one person and cannot do everything on her own even though people may call her "Superwoman". She acknowledges that she has weaknesses and sometimes finds herself crying more than she'd like to. Even as she faces the rain flying in her face, she continues to smile through the pain as she wonders if she will ever get tired of being a superwoman.


The song speaks to the struggles of everyday women and the expectations placed on them to be both successful and perfect. It acknowledges that even "Superwomen" have moments of vulnerability and breakdowns. The song encourages women to acknowledge their limitations and not be afraid to take their time because everyone has their own pace. Meghan is candid and realistic in her lyrics, and by doing so, she manages to capture the hearts of many listeners who can see themselves in her words, and know exactly what it feels like to be a superwoman.
